All of our products are ISPM15 certified to ensure that they meet the International Standards for Phytosanitary Measures No. 15. This standard is crucial in preventing the spread of pests and diseases in wooden packaging, which is especially important for international trade.
ISPM15 certification requires wooden packaging to be made from debarked wood and then subjected to heat treatment and fumigation. The wood must be heated at a minimum of 56 degrees Celsius for 30 minutes to meet the certification requirements. By using ISPM15-certified packaging, our customers benefit from having pest-free wooden packaging, hassle-free international transport, lighter packaging, and reduced risk of mould and bacteria contamination.
